To clarify, the popup is displaying on the Frontend but it is not updating with the latest changes that you have made. Do I understand it correctly?
If yes, then, you may want to reach out to your host and ask them to clear/purge all server-side cache and check it again if that helps you with your problem.
Or, if your website is using any CDN or Cloudflare, then try to disable the cache temporarily to see if that makes any difference.
